本题要求实现判断给定整数奇偶性的函数
时间: 2023-06-05 21:47:45 浏览: 251
可以使用以下函数来判断一个整数的奇偶性:
```python
def is_odd(number):
if number % 2 == 0:
return False
else:
return True
```
这个函数接受一个整数作为参数,使用模运算(%)来判断该整数是否为偶数。如果它是偶数,返回 False;否则返回 True,表示它是奇数。
相关问题
C语言本题要求实现判断给定整数奇偶性的函数
好的,我明白了。以下是实现判断给定整数奇偶性的函数的C语言代码:
```
#include <stdio.h>
int is_even(int num) {
if (num % 2 == 0) {
return 1;
} else {
return 0;
}
}
int main() {
int num;
printf("请输入一个整数:");
scanf("%d", &num);
if (is_even(num)) {
printf("%d是偶数\n", num);
} else {
printf("%d是奇数\n", num);
}
return 0;
}
```
该函数接收一个整数参数,并返回一个整数类型,表示该数是否为偶数。在is_even函数中,判断输入的num是否能被2整除,如果能则返回1(表示偶数),否则返回0(表示奇数)。在main函数中,调用is_even函数来判断用户输入的数是奇数还是偶数,并输出结果。
本题要求实现判断给定整数奇偶性的函数。
可以使用取模运算符(%)来判断一个整数是否为偶数。如果一个数能够被 2 整除,那么它一定是偶数,反之则是奇数。
```python
def is_even(n):
if n % 2 == 0:
return True
else:
return False
```
或者
```python
def is_even(n):
return n % 2 == 0
```
如果是偶数则返回True,否则返回False.
阅读全文